Renowned Ugandan singer Mansour Ssemanda alias King Saha denies using drugs following continued rumors of him being addicted to alcohol and drugs.
A few months ago King Saha was bedridden and reports attributed his sickness to excessive use of drugs.
While speaking in his recent interview with the media, he denied taking alcohol or any related intoxicated substances.
He went to say that his eyes are always red due to the dusty road in his residence.
“Because of that road , people see me and think I am high on substances”,he partly said in the interview.
He further throw light on the challenging journey from Nakawuka to Munyonyo, emphasizing how the dusty road creates a misleading impression.
“But I can tell you; by the time you move from Nakawuka to Munyonyo, everyone will think you are on drugs,” he Said.
He called attention to the urgent need for road maintenance, Saha appealed to the Uganda National Roads Authority (UNRA), stating, “UNRA should come out and help us on that road because even if I take off my glasses right now, you will join me to call for repairs on that road.
Responding to queries about his trademark sunglasses, Saha explained that the eyewear serves a dual purpose, shielding his eyes from the troublesome road conditions and maintaining a signature look.
